Upon conversion of an out-of-state financial institution, the resulting commercial bank:

(1)possesses all of the rights, privileges, immunities, and powers of a commercial bank;
(2)unless otherwise provided in this chapter, is subject to all of the duties, restrictions, obligations, and liabilities of a commercial bank; and
(3)succeeds by operation of law to all rights and property of the converting out-of-state financial institution and shall be subjected to all debts, obligations, and liabilities of the converting out-of-state financial institution as if the commercial bank had incurred the debts and liabilities.
